                Yeah.. you need a machine with both power and wire speed controls as well as a shielding gas. Fluxcore wire and a 110v machine with limited controls will take a lot of time and effort welding thin sheet metal.

                Yes you set your power and amps based on wire size as well as the thickness of material being welded. You need more control in order to weld thin sheet metal. The cheaper machines can weld it. It's easier to weld when your running .025" wire and a shielding gas. That is if you want to make it clean and not blow through every 2 minutes or having to grind down the snots left from welding too cold.
